Description du revers A rendition of an original piece of `playing card money`, used during the years of New France as makeshift currency. Features the King of Hearts (Charlemagne) wearing a cloak edged with a scarf-like pattern, while the fleur-de-lis (a symbol of the French monarch) visible throughout. It is based on a card from the Canadian archives.
